    The SAP error message ESH_ENG_CDS_ABAP009 indicates that there is an issue with the activation of a Core Data Services (CDS) view in the ABAP environment, specifically that the activation is being attempted in a cross-client manner, which is not allowed for certain objects.
    
    Cause: The error typically arises when: You are trying to activate a CDS view that is defined as client-specific in a client-independent context. The CDS view or the underlying data model is not designed to be activated across clients, which is a restriction in the SAP system to maintain data integrity and consistency.
    Solution: To resolve this error, you can take the following steps: Check the Client Settings: Ensure that you are in the correct client where the CDS view is intended to be activated.
